Brussels Challenges Beijing on Rare Earth Exports Ahead of Key Summit

Spread the love

The European Union has recently stepped up its efforts to challenge China on two critical fronts: the export of rare earth elements and the geopolitical tensions surrounding the conflict in Ukraine. These talks come in anticipation of a major EU-China summit set to take place in Beijing on July 24 and 25.

Importance of Rare Earth Elements

Rare earth elements are indispensable for a variety of high-tech industries, making them strategically significant for the EU’s technological advancement and economic security. Recognizing this, EU officials have highlighted the necessity for:

  • Stable and fair trade practices regarding rare earth exports
  • Ensuring the reliability of supply chains crucial for Europe’s industry

Concerns Over Ukraine Conflict

In addition to resource trade, the EU has expressed strong concerns about China’s position in the ongoing Ukraine war. EU representatives are urging Beijing to play a constructive role in promoting peace efforts, emphasizing the importance of:

  • Diplomatic responsibility
  • Global stability and conflict resolution

Significance of the Upcoming Summit

The forthcoming summit in Beijing will serve as a key platform for both the EU and China to:

  1. Address complex issues surrounding rare earth element exports
  2. Discuss and potentially influence China’s role in the Ukraine conflict
  3. Strengthen their diplomatic relationship through candid yet constructive dialogue

Brussels’ proactive stance reflects the EU’s broader commitment to securing its supply chains and fostering global peace. EU leaders aim to engage China openly while seeking collaborative solutions that benefit both parties and contribute to international stability.
